Media Office of Chief (Dr.) Peter Taiwo Ogundeji (A.K.A. APATA), a distinguished philanthropist, entrepreneur, and Chief Executive Officer of the APATA CARES FOUNDATION, has announced a series of week-long events to commemorate his 40th birthday anniversary in a statement.
The celebration according to the statement will feature a range of activities reflecting Dr Ogundeji’s lifelong passion for education, empowerment, health, and community development across the Osun West Senatorial District.
The week-long celebration will commence on Monday, 17 November, with a Colloquium and Book Launch at Leisure Spring Hotel, along Osogbo–Iwo Road, beginning at 10:00 a.m.
The event will bring together guests, community leaders, scholars, and well-wishers to reflect on Dr Ogundeji’s impactful journey and contributions to social development.
This will be followed by health and wellness activities as Apata Cares Foundation sponsors a comprehensive Free Eye Care Outreach on Tuesday, 18 November. It is expected to
feature free eye examinations, distribution of corrective and reading glasses, provision of essential drugs, and cataract surgeries. These medical interventions will take place simultaneously in Ejigbo, Ede, Iwo, and Ikire, all within the Osun West Senatorial District.
On Wednesday, 19 November, a Novelty Football Match to symbolise unity, friendship, and healthy competition among communities in Osun West between Iwo All Stars and Ejigbo All Stars is expected to come up at the Iwo Township Stadium.
A youth and women empowerment program comes up on Thursday, 20 at Legacy Hall, Ola Town, in Ejigbo Local Government Area.
Sewing machines, hair dryers, and other equipment will be distributed to apprentices and small-scale entrepreneurs to boost self-reliance and local productivity.
A special prayer in honour of the celebrant will be held at Apata Castle, opposite Gbolaru Palace, Ilupeju Estate, Ido-Osun, Egbedore Local Government Area,on Friday, 21 November.
The event would be climaxed with a Grand Birthday Celebration at De-Legend Event Centre, beside Grace Cooking Gas, Dele Yes Sir area, Osogbo.
